The Oaks Vet Clinic (My Vet) posted this yesterday and thought I’d share. Here’s 7 Hidden Pet Poisons I didn’t know about.
Gum and Mints can contain Xylitol; even small amounts of xylitol can cause h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), seizures, liver failure, or even death.
Acetaminophen (Tylenol) can cause severe liver damage in pets, even at low doses. It can also damage red blood cells and lead to other health problems.
Sago Palm is extremely toxic to cats and dogs; all parts of the plant are toxic, but the seeds are the most toxic and can result in death.

Cypress, it’s (almost) September — which means we’re heading into one of the most common seasons for roof damage. With fall storms, high winds, and hurricane remnants on the way, now is the time to get ahead of potential issues.
You should have your roof professionally inspected at least once a year, but also after any major storm or extreme weather event. For older roofs or homes surrounded by large trees, twice-yearly inspections — in spring and fall — are even better at catching issues before they become costly repairs. If your roof is over 15 years old, you should be prepared for signs of wear and tear, possible leaks, and even the need to start budgeting for a replacement.

‘77433’ is now the Most Moved into U.S. Zip Code of 2025 🤯
I mean, I knew Cypress was booming, but wow. According to MovingPlace.com, the ‘77433’ zip code had a move-in count of 3,638. Behind it was New Braunfels (surprising but not really, they are on the rise). Keep in mind, this is only from the start of the year. Cypress is described as a ‘magnet for families and young professionals who want more space and a quieter lifestyle.
What this means for you: This could drive up property values, stimulate the economy with new businesses (which we’ve clearly seen recently). On the other hand, it may also put pressure on roads, schools, and a tighter housing market.
Why I’m not worried: As I covered recently [Read It Here: “The Cypress Commute Rundown,”] the roadway infrastructure takes time to build — yes, however our officials have seen the light which is why you see talks of SH-99 expansion, multiple road tie-ins throughout the 77433 zip code, more schools opening, and more businesses to service the incoming population.
